II. OBJECTIVES
This skill-based integrated course aims at developing students’ language proficiency at B1+ level. At the end of the course,
1
In terms of Listening, students can:
- generally follow and understand the main points of extended discussions/ speech taking places nearby on familiar matters;
- understand announcements and messages on concrete and abstract topics spoken in standard dialect at normal speed; and
- understand the main points of clear standard speech on familiar matters regularly encountered in work, school, leisure, etc.
In terms of Speaking, students can:
- communicate with some confidence on familiar routine and non-routine matters such as health, travelling, fashion, etc. related to his/ her interests and
professional fields;
- exchange, check and confirm information, deal with less routine situations and explain why something is a problem;
- express thoughts on more abstract, cultural topics such as films, books, music, etc.; and
- enter unprepared into conversations of familiar topics, express personal opinions and exchange information on topics that are familiar or personal
interest or pertinent to everyday life.
